如何使用查询分析器检测数据库连接字符串
数据库连接字符串为: 
 Initial   Catalog=xydb;server=192.168.0.10;User   ID=sa;Password=sa 
 如何在查询分析器中对些连接字符串进行检测? 
 谢谢!
------解决方案--------------------试试这个吧~~~~~~ 
 create proc spex 
 as 
 if exists(SELECT * FROM OPENDATASOURCE( 'SQLOLEDB ', 'Initial Catalog=xydb;server=192.168.0.10;User ID=sa;Password=sa ').Northwind.dbo.Categories) 
 print  'success! ' 
 else 
 print  'wrong!! ' 
------解决方案--------------------如果是,用楼上说的openrowset就可行。
------解决方案--------------------openrowset 或者opendatasource 都可以测试是否可以连接的。   
 直接执行时不行的。   
 另外在sql 2005 中执行这两个的话,还需要进行应用程序的外围配置